Profile
People With Disabilities is a local government office in Carmel Hamlet, New York, dedicated to supporting individuals with disabilities through a variety of public services and advocacy programs. As part of Putnam County’s broader human services network, the office plays a pivotal role in promoting accessibility, inclusion, and equal opportunity for residents with physical, intellectual, and developmental disabilities. The organization offers guidance navigating state and federal disability resources, assists with benefits enrollment, and coordinates support for independent living.
Notable for its collaboration with other government agencies, nonprofits, and healthcare providers, the office ensures that people with disabilities receive comprehensive support tailored to their needs. The team is deeply involved in community engagement initiatives, including accessibility planning and public education efforts to reduce stigma and increase awareness. Services are culturally competent and aim to empower individuals in their personal, educational, and vocational goals.
Key Services:
– Assistance with disability benefits and services
– Advocacy and support for accessibility and inclusion
– Referrals to local and state disability programs
– Coordination of independent living resources
– Public education and awareness campaigns
– Collaboration with community and government agencies
– Crisis intervention and case management
– Individualized planning and support services
